Woodward 9908-1501 GS16 Gas Valve

The 9908-1501 is a Woodward brand gas valve model in the GS16 series. Woodward is an American brand of gas combustion control systems, widely used in power generation, oil and gas industries.

The main function of this gas valve is to control the flow and pressure of the gas to meet the needs of combustion and industrial processes. It usually has high reliability and long life, which can ensure the normal operation and safety of industrial equipment.

There are many ways to control gas valves, each of which has its advantages and disadvantages. The following are the advantages and disadvantages of several common gas valve control methods:

Manual control: We can easily and simply adjust the gas valve without external energy. It’s highly reliable and ideal for small flows, low pressure differences, and infrequent adjustments. However, it requires manual operation, has limited adjustment accuracy and response speed, and isn’t suitable for highly automated systems.

Electric control: We can remotely control and automate the gas valve with electric control. It offers high adjustment accuracy and fast response times, making it suitable for highly automated systems. However, it requires external power, has lower reliability, and higher maintenance costs.

Pneumatic control: Pneumatic control provides high adjustment accuracy and fast response times, making it suitable for applications demanding rapid response and precision. However, it requires compressed air and pneumatic components, which can increase maintenance costs.

Hydraulic control: Hydraulic control offers high thrust and torque, making it ideal for applications requiring significant force. However, it requires hydraulic oil and components, which can increase maintenance costs and make it susceptible to factors like oil temperature and leaks.

Regulating valve control: We can continuously adjust flow and pressure with regulating valve control, making it suitable for applications requiring precise gas flow and pressure control. However, it requires additional installation of regulating valves, increasing system complexity and cost.

In conclusion, when selecting a gas valve control mode, we must carefully evaluate our specific needs and application. Each control method has its own advantages and disadvantages, so we must consider all factors to make the best choice for our application.
